Tar and gravel roof services typically invol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ofs covered with a layer of asphalt-based tar and a protective gravel surface. This roofing system is known for its durability and affordability, making it a popular choice for commercial properties, industrial facilities, and some residential buildings. Service providers may assist with inspecting the roof for damage, applying new layers of tar, replacing worn gravel, or performing waterproofing treatments to ensure the roof maintains its protective qualities over time.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of these roofs and help prevent leaks or structural issues.

One of the primary problems addressed by tar and gravel roof services is water infiltration.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ause cracks, blisters, or punctures in the roofing membrane, leading to leaks that can damage the interior of a property. Service providers can identify and repair these vulnerabilities, sealing cracks and replacing damaged sections to restore the roof’s integrity. Additionally, gravel surfaces can become dislodged or worn down, reducing their protective ability and exposing the underlying materials to UV rays and weathering. Regular inspections and repairs help mitigate these issues and maintain the roof’s overall performance.

Properties that commonly utilize tar and gravel roofing include commercial warehouses, office buildings, and multi-family residential complexes. These roofs are often chosen for their ability to cover large, flat surfaces efficiently and their capacity to withstand heavy foot traffic and environmental stressors. Industrial facilities that require a robust roofing system also frequently opt for tar and gravel roofs due to their resilience and ease of repair. While less common in residential settings, some larger homes or flat-roofed structures may also benefit from this roofing method, especially when durability and cost-effectiveness are priorities.

What is involved in tar and gravel roof services? Tar and gravel roof services typically include repair, maintenance, and installation of built-up roofing systems that use asphalt and aggregate layers.

How do I know if my tar and gravel roof needs service? Signs such as leaks, cracks, or excessive granule loss can indicate the need for professional inspection and repair services.

What are common issues addressed during tar and gravel roof service? Common issues include membrane damage, ponding water, blistering, and deterioration of the gravel or asphalt layers.

How often should a tar and gravel roof be maintained? Regular inspections and maintenance are recommended, typically annually or after severe weather conditions.
